The Nuggets’ Betting Odds For The NBA Title Dropping

  • The Denver Nuggets have won 12 of their previous 14 games.
  • The Nuggets’ NBA Championship odds improved considerably in March, with many bettors backing the team.
  • The Boston Celtics vs. Denver Nuggets is the most likely NBA Finals matchup, according to the latest odds.

The Denver Nuggets’ betting odds to win NBA title are dropping rapidly in the build-up to the post-season. According to BetUS, at +350, the Nuggets have the second-best odds to win the 2023-24 NBA Championship. Currently, the Boston Celtics (+225) have the top odds to win it all, but the Nuggets are quickly catching up.

They’ve moved clear of the Los Angeles Clippers, who went into the month roughly tied with the Nuggets to win the NBA title. Two weeks ago, the Clippers and Nuggets were +450 to capture the championship.

LAs are now +500, with the third-shortest odds to win their first Larry O’Brien Trophy. While the Nuggets are in top form, the Clippers have dropped four of their previous five games. At +500, the Clippers have an implied chance to win the NBA Championship of 16.7%.

In the meantime, the Nuggets’ implied probability has jumped from approximately 18.2% to 22.2% in March. The odds shift is due to an impressive recent streak of success from the Nuggets. Following a 115-112 win over the Minnesota Timberwolves on Tuesday, March 19, the Nuggets are winners in 12 of their last 14 assignments.

Jokić Takes Control of MVP Race

In addition to the Nuggets’ NBA Championship odds taking flight, Jokić is well on his way to capturing his third NBA MVP title. The native of Sombor, Serbia, is a -285 favorite to win the top regular season honor this season.

He holds a significant advantage over OKC’s Shai Gilgeous-Alexander, who is well behind with +400 odds. At -285, Jokić has a 74% chance of winning MVP, while Gilgeous-Alexander has a 20% probability.

Entering March, Jokić was at -150 to win league MVP. This represents an improvement from a 60% chance to a 74% in less than a month. Before the 76ers’ Joel Embiid’s injury in late January, him and Jokic were neck and neck for the 2023-24 NBA MVP.

The Serb is now in control after another fantastic season for the Nuggets. Currently, the 29-year-old center is averaging 26 points, 12.3 rebounds, and nine assists per contest. He is shooting 58.2% from the field and 35.4% from beyond the three-point stripe.

Just one assist per game away from averaging a triple-double in 2023-24, Jokić is the clear choice for MVP. Can he lead the Nuggets to consecutive NBA titles, though? According to BetOnline, the Celtics’ Jayson Tatum might have something to say about that in the 2024 NBA Finals.
